Buch, Deutsch, 925 Seiten, Inkl. CD-ROM, Format (B × H): 181 mm x 251 mm, Gewicht: 1664 g
Konzepte und Notationen in UML 2.0, Java 5, C++ und C#. Algorithmik und Software-Technik. Anwendungen
Buch, Deutsch, 925 Seiten, Inkl. CD-ROM, Format (B × H): 181 mm x 251 mm, Gewicht: 1664 g
Reihe: Spektrum Lehrbücher der Informatik
ISBN: 978-3-8274-1410-6
Verlag: Spektrum-Akademischer Vlg
Das Standardlehrbuch zu den Grundlagen der Informatik:
Über 15.000 verkaufte Exemplare der ersten Auflage
In diesem zweifarbig gestalteten Lehrbuch werden in didaktisch vorbildlicher Weise die Grundlagen der Informatik vermittelt. Im Mittelpunkt stehen die Konzepte der objektorientierten Programmierung, die in den Notationen UML, Java und C++ dargestellt werden.
Das Buch kann zur Vorlesungsbegleitung, zum Selbststudium und
zum Nachschlagen verwendet werden.
Die zweite Auflage wurde vollständig überarbeitet und aktualisiert:
- Umstellung auf UML 2.0
- Umstellung auf Java 2 (V 1.5)
- detaillierte Erläuterung der damit verbundenen Neuerungen
Der Einstieg in die professionelle Programmierung und Software-Technik:
- Ohne Vorkenntnisse starten, lernen, verstehen, anwenden, Erfolg haben!
- Arbeiten mit den Programmiersprachen Java, C++ und C#
- Einsatz der Modellierungssprache UML 2.0
- Systematisches Vorgehen: Pflichtenheft, OOA-Modell, GUI-Konzept, OOD-Modell, Programm, Reviews und Testen
- Theorie & Praxis, Konzepte & Notationen; Algorithmen & Datenstrukturen
- Anwendungen: kaufmännisch, technisch, Grafik, Multimedia
- Fallbeispiele:Kinoplatz-Verwaltung, Leiterplatten-Layout, Artikel-Lieferantenverwaltung, Wetterstation, Grafik-Editor, Roboteranimation, Pool-Billard
- Moderne CASE-Werkzeuge und Programmierumgebungen
Die optimale Lernunterstützung:
- Durchgehend zweifarbig
- 500 Grafiken
- 300 Aufgaben und Lösungen
- 200 lauffähige Programme
- Alle notwendigen Werkzeuge und Compiler auf CD-ROM
Bonus: 5-stündiger e-learning-Kurs "Schnelleinstieg Java" inkl. Test und Zertifikat
Stimmen zur 1. Auflage:
"Das Buch ist sowohl den Studenten der Informatik als auch den Studenten anderer Fachrichtungen uneingeschränkt zu empfehlen, da es neben umfangreichen Beispielen und Fallstudien auch zahlreiche Tools und Dokumentationen auf der beiliegenden CD enthält. […]
Das Werk ist eine aktuelle, praxisorientierte und exzellentgeschriebene Einführung in die Grundlagen der Informatik. […]"
iX Magazin für Professionelle Informationstechnik
Zielgruppe
Upper undergraduate
Autoren/Hrsg.
Fachgebiete
- Mathematik | Informatik EDV | Informatik EDV & Informatik Allgemein
- Mathematik | Informatik EDV | Informatik Informatik Logik, formale Sprachen, Automaten
- Mathematik | Informatik EDV | Informatik Programmierung | Softwareentwicklung Programmierung: Methoden und Allgemeines
- Technische Wissenschaften Energietechnik | Elektrotechnik Elektrotechnik
Weitere Infos & Material
LE 1 Einführung - Computersysteme und Informatik
LE 2 Einführung - Internet, Web und HTML
LE 3 Grundlagen der Programmierung - Einführung
LE 4 Grundlagen der Programmierung - Objekte und Klassen (Teil 1)
LE 5 Grundlagen der Programmierung - Objekte und Klassen (Teil 2)
LE 6 Grundlagen der Programmierung - Ereignisse und Attribute
LE 7 Grundlagen der Programmierung - Operationen
LE 8 Grundlagen der Programmierung - Kontrollstrukturen
LE 9 Grundlagen der Programmierung - Vererbung und Polymorphismus
LE 10 Grundlagen der Programmierung - Schnittstellen, Pakete, Ereignisse
LE 11 Grundlagen der Programmierung - Datenstrukturen
LE 12 Grundlagen der Programmierung - Persistenz
LE 13 Algorithmik und Software-Technik - Algorithmen und ihre Verifikation
LE 14 Algorithmik und Software-Technik - Überprüfung von Dokumenten und Verbesserung des Prozesses
LE 15 Algorithmik und Software-Technik - Überprüfung von Dokumenten und Verbesserung des Prozesses
LE 16 Algorithmik und Software-Technik - Aufwand von Algorithmen
LE 17 Algorithmik und Software-Technik - Listen und Bäume
LE 18 Algorithmik und Software-Technik - Suchen und Sortieren sowie Generische Typen
LE 19 Anwendungen - Dialoggestaltung
LE 20 Anwendungen - E/A-Gestaltung
LE 21 Anwendungen - kaufmännisch/technisch
LE 22 Anwendungen - Grafik/Multimedia
LE 23 Ausblicke - Einführung in C++
LE 24 Ausblicke - Einführung in C++ (2. Teil) und C#
Anhang A Checklisten, Richtlinien, Erstellungsregeln
Anhang B Prozeßverbesserung und ihre Formulare
Anhang C Praktika